Glossary of Beauty and Cosmetics Terms

  • Skincare. Skincare refers to the range of practices that support skin health, improve its appearance, and alleviate skin conditions. Skincare routines typically involve cleansing, toning, and moisturizing.
  • Makeup. Makeup is a collection of products used to enhance or alter the appearance of the face. It includes items like foundation, lipstick, and eyeshadow.
  • Fragrance. Fragrance refers to the pleasant smell of a substance, often used in perfumes and colognes. It can be derived from natural or synthetic sources.
  • Natural Ingredients. Natural ingredients are derived from plants, animals, or minerals and are used in beauty products for their beneficial properties. Examples include aloe vera, shea butter, and essential oils.
  • Cruelty-Free. Cruelty-free products are those that have not been tested on animals. This term is important for consumers who prioritize ethical and humane practices.
  • Vegan. Vegan products are those that do not contain any animal-derived ingredients. This term is important for consumers who follow a vegan lifestyle or have ethical concerns about animal products.
  • SPF. SPF, or Sun Protection Factor, is a measure of the fraction of sunburn-producing UV rays that reach the skin. Higher SPF values indicate greater protection.
  • Exfoliation. Exfoliation is the process of removing dead skin cells from the surface of the skin. It can be done mechanically or chemically and helps to improve skin texture and appearance.
  • Serums. Serums are lightweight, fast-absorbing liquids that contain a high concentration of active ingredients. They are used to target specific skin concerns like aging, hyperpigmentation, or acne.
  • Matte Finish. A matte finish is a makeup look that is flat and non-shiny. It is often achieved with matte foundations, powders, and lipsticks.
  • Dewy Finish. A dewy finish is a makeup look that is glowing and radiant. It is often achieved with creamy foundations, highlighters, and lip glosses.
  • Primers. Primers are base products used before makeup to create a smooth canvas and help makeup last longer. They can be used to address specific skin concerns like pores, redness, or oiliness.
  • Setting Spray. Setting spray is a product used to set makeup and help it last longer. It can also be used to refresh makeup throughout the day.
  • Eyeshadow Palette. An eyeshadow palette is a collection of eyeshadow shades in one compact. It can include a range of colors and finishes like matte, shimmer, and metallic.
  • Lipstick. Lipstick is a cosmetic product used to add color, texture, and protection to the lips. It can come in a variety of finishes like matte, satin, and glossy.
  • Mascara. Mascara is a cosmetic product used to darken, thicken, and define the eyelashes. It can come in a variety of formulas like waterproof, lengthening, and volumizing.
  • Blush. Blush is a cosmetic product used to add color to the cheeks. It can come in a variety of forms like powder, cream, and liquid.
  • Highlighter. Highlighter is a cosmetic product used to add a glow to the high points of the face. It can come in a variety of forms like powder, cream, and liquid.

Common Mistakes

When it comes to beauty and cosmetics, there are a few common mistakes that people make. One of the biggest mistakes is not understanding your skin type. Knowing whether you have dry, oily, combination, or sensitive skin can help you choose the right products and avoid irritation. Another common mistake is not removing your makeup before bed. Leaving makeup on overnight can clog pores and lead to breakouts. It's also important to patch test new products before using them on your face. This can help you avoid allergic reactions and irritation. Finally, don't forget to read the labels. Understanding the ingredients in your products can help you make informed decisions and avoid harmful chemicals.
